For centuries, people on this flat island in the middle of the ocean have made a living from fishing. But the large fishing fleet has disappeared, and the fishermen's expertise is being forgotten. The coastal community is one of the residents' answers to how coastal culture can be preserved in a new era.

We are on our way to a municipality where a third of the residents are members of the KYSTEN Association. It is admittedly the smallest municipality in the country with 208 residents, but so great that 66 have found a place in the local coastal team! We have an agreement to meet at Konjakken.
